On the first day of the last test session, before the first race which will take place this weekend at Phillip Island, Marco Melandri won on his Ducati ahead of the two Kawasakis of Tom Sykes and Johnny Rea . Loris Baz on his BMW finished in eleventh position. In Supersport, Lucas Mahias (Yamaha) was the fastest while Jules Cluzel and Mike di Meglio (also on R6) were sixth and twelfth.

The first morning test session took place in fairly difficult conditions due to a fairly violent wind. The reigning World Champion Johnny Rea fell without gravity in turn 11, just like Jordi Torres in turn 2.

Marco Melandri finished the day in first position on his Panigale, while his teammate Chaz Davies struggled a little in tenth place. Johnny Rea and his teammate Tom Sykes placed their Kawasakis in second and third positions. Leon Camier achieved a good fourth time on his Honda, ahead of the Yamaha of Michael van der Mark and the Panigale of Xavi Fores. Loris Baz continued to improve the settings of his BMW Althea which he had started to perfect during the Portimao tests. He had two S 1000 RRs made available to him by Genesio Bevilacqua.

En Supersport, Lucas Mahias honored his recent title of World Champion and achieved the best time ahead of Federico Caricasulo et Luke Stapleford. Two Yamahas preceded a Triumph. Beginner in the category, Sandra Cortese, from Moto2, ranked fourth on Yamaha ahead of the Kawasaki of Kenan Sofuoglu.

Jules cluzel, who moved from Honda to Yamaha within the NRT team, set the sixth time. Mike di Meglio, newcomer to the category, placed the GMT6 Yamaha R94 in twelfth place. He was 1.027 behind the leader Lucas Mahias and his room for improvement was substantial.

A second day of testing will take place this Tuesday, before the first event of the year begins in Australia on Friday.
